BANGALORE, INDIA: Bangalore-based Adecco India, the Indian arm of HR service firm Adecco SA, today announced the acquisition of blue collar temping company Ajinkya.

Advertisment

Post-acquisition, Ajinkya will become part of Adecco India and will operate as Adecco’s industrial staffing division headed by C R Kale, the founder director of Ajinkya.

The acquisition will give Adecco significant foothold in the burgeoning blue collar temping market in India.

“Blue collar temping is the next big thing in the Indian HR arena given the all round industrial growth. But the segment lacks a single large player at the national level to deliver the volumes required by India’s economic growth. The acquisition assumes relevance as it weds Ajinkya’s expertise in the blue collar space with Adecco’s nationwide footprint,” said Sudhakar Balakrishnan, CEO of Adecco India and Middle East.

Asked about Adecco’s presence in IT, Sudhakar said, “We have separate wing for IT recruitment and have clients like HP and Cisco. We have what is called value staffing where we do temporary staffing for short-term projects etc.”
